I was recently given a gas tank by the same fellow I bought my 37' from. He swears it is a Cord gas tank. The tank in my 37' is roughly the same width as the frame, and when viewed from the end, rectangular with rounded corners. The tank given me is kind of jelly bean shaped and would have to fit in the trunk area on the extreme right hand side, judging from the filler neck, and the drain plug. This tank is sort of palm beach tan in color with horse hair pads glued to it in places. Do open cords have different tanks than closed cars? Should I set this tank out with the trash on monday morning?
